So some of the Sidi armor pieces are excellent and lots of people use them. Problem is they look just like epic armor. Now, epic armor isn't bad-looking, but if you want the epic armor look, just use the epic armor. If you are using something else, you should have another look, not the epic look. My idea is to change the Sidi armor to look like the crafted Inconnu armor. It makes sense. Inconnu came with SI release, just like Sidi armor. Inconnu armor looks cool, but no one uses it because it isn't has good as sigil/dragonsworn. I've seriously only seen two people ever wearing the inconnu armor and one of them was a thid buffbot. (Coolest looking buffbot ever, btw.) New armor graphics would not have to be designed. The code is written, just switch it around. Easy-Peasy-Lemon-Squeezey. Would add more variety into the game and do so pretty easily. So to reiterate: Mythic/EA/Bioware, make Sidi armor pieces look like inconnu armor pieces. And this goes for Mid/Hib too btw. I think that would be really cool. It could be what you do for the 10th anniv of SI release, but sooner than that would be better.

Sidi armor is the best looking armor in the game. Just so happens that the last time they gave a serious effort in armor skins was when they made Epic armor - which in most cases, is still the best looking armor in the game.

So I vote no on changing Sidi armor skins.
However I stand by my suggestion that they upgrade the crafting system, and include the ability for crafters to "specialize" in any of the armor skins (with an additional imbue slot). This would be something LGM crafters could do, but they have to pick one (per craft) that they specialize in. This kind of diversity in the crafting community would be a boon for the game and the economy of the game.

Move away from "I can make everything....taking orders" to "I make Inconnu Plate, taking orders..."
